Tata Harrier EV vs Mahindra XEV 9e: Design Differences

Let’s start with their sizes: 

Models

Tata Harrier

Mahindra XEV 9e

Length

4605 mm

4789 mm (+184 mm)

Width

1922 mm (+15 mm)

1907 mm

Height

1718 mm (+24 mm)

1694 mm

Wheelbase

2741 mm

2775 mm (+34 mm)

The Tata Harrier EV’s specifications have not been revealed yet. However, since it shares a similar body style and design with its ICE counterpart, we have considered the latter’s dimensions for reference. 

Mahindra XEV 9e
 

It is evident that the Harrier EV and the Mahindra XEV 9e are pretty similar in size, though the XEV 9e is longer due to its coupe-style design. It also has a longer wheelbase too, which should result in a more spacious cabin. On the other hand, the Harrier EV should be slightly wider and taller than the XEV 9e.

What is proven for the Harrier nameplate, and is also the case with the XEV 9e, is that both the SUVs are to command a strong road presence.

Design-wise, the Harrier EV and XEV 9e have a few things in common too, like their connected LED DRLs at the front and vertically stacked headlights. 

Mahindra XEV 9e
 

What is different in their faces is that the Harrier EV’s grille and bumper have a lot of vertical and horizontal slat lines while the XEV 9e’s closed-off grille is kept neater, giving it a futuristic look. The position of the brand logo is also different. The XEV 9e has it on its bonnet, while the Harrier EV keeps it traditionally over its grille.

Mahindra XEV 9e
 

Move to the side, and the two EVs look a lot different as both have a completely different stance. The  Harrier EV has the traditional SUV silhouette, while the XEV 9e has a sportier sloping coupe-style roofline. The  XEV 9e’s sportiness is further accentuated by the thick body cladding that extends to the wheel arches. The Harrier EV has it in a more sober way.

The Design Differences Between The Tata Harrier EV SUV And The glimpse
 

The Harrier EV has traditional door handles, body-coloured ORVMs and redesigned alloys with aero-specific covers, compared to the more modern flush-type door handles, similar body-coloured ORVMs, and 19-inch dual-tone alloy wheels in the Mahindra XEV 9e.

The Design Differences Between The Tata Harrier EV SUV And The snapshot
 

At the back, the Tata Harrier EV has connected LED lighting placed on a gloss black panel on the tailgate. It also has a shark-fin antenna, a roof-mounted spoiler, and a silver skid plate.

Mahindra XEV 9e
 

In comparison, the Mahindra XEV 9e, due to its dipping roofline, doesn’t carry a spoiler. Its connected LED lighting is inverted L-shaped, unlike the straight-lined lighting in the Harrier EV, which is a very signature element in many Tata cars. A silver skid plate also stays mutual.
